Saturday Reading Assistance Program For Students

City officials say the Villa-Parke Community Center is offering a free monthly Saturday reading assistance program for students in 1st – 6th grade. They say the program which is affiliated with the non-profit organization, Kids Reading to Succeed, is designed to help children improve their reading skills and to develop a love for reading. Officials say one-on-one tutoring is also available the first Saturday of each month from 8:50 a.m. to 11:00 a.m.

To register or for more information please visit Villa-Parke Community Center at 363 E. Villa St. or call them at (626) 744-6530. Parents are encouraged to sign up their children for the program at least one week in advance, but drop-ins are welcomed; as well.
